>Please find attached the Final Report of the ALS Mobilization Working 
>Party (ALS-Mob-WP).
>
>I will be happy to formally make a presentation to the ALAC and 
>At-Large Community at Maureen's convenience, and I can also do 
>presentations to any RALO that wishes.
>
>The report is the result of ten months of work by the WP. Everything 
>in it was determined by consensus and the vast majority by unanimous
>consensus.
>
>The next step is a review by the ALAC and RALOs. Presumably the 
>latter will be initiated by the ALAC Members from each region.
>
>Once the ALAC, with the support of the RALOs provides approval, the 
>substance of the report will go to the ICANN Board for their 
>agreement (or non-objection). Any Bylaw changes will be submitted to 
>the Board and would be subject to the standard Bylaw amendment 
>procedure as specified under Bylaws Article 25. In parallel with this 
>report being submitted to the ALAC, the proposed Bylaw changes are 
>being submitted to the Office of the General Counsel for their review 
>and comments.
>
>Should the ALAC or Board require further modifications to the report, 
>the WP will be reconvened.
